## Changelog — Tidemark Widget 3.2

Defaults changed. Read before touching anything.

- Refresh interval now hourly, not every 15 min. Harbor feeds from the Pellisport aggregator throttle aggressive polling.
- Lunar-offset correction is on by default. Disable only for legacy Kestrel Bay deployments.
- Chart units default to metric. The imperial fallback flag is deprecated and will be removed in 3.4.
- Cache eviction is now time-based, not size-based.

New installs should start from the default configuration values listed below.

config for kahap-taweg:
oliox:
  pin: 8609
  tenant: casath
  seal: seal_632a4a6f
  metrics_host: metrics.oliox.nelvrogrid.example
  standby_team: keleth
  escalation: briiel-oliwyn
  nonce: e2397c

**Vendor note: Inkmill markdown pipeline**

Rendering for Parchway docs is outsourced to Inkmill under an annual contract, renewing each March. They handle sanitization and PDF export; we own the upload queue. SLA: 4-hour response on rendering failures. Escalate only after two failed retries. Their support desk is reachable at the address below.

billing contact of hahaf-baguf = zorael.tammir.jorius@sivrelhq.internal

Subject: Handover — TranscodeMeadow farm DB duties

Hey Priya,

Wrapping up my rotation on the TranscodeMeadow farm, so here's the short version. The job queue DB gets hammered between 2–4am when the overnight render batches land; the read replica lags around then, so don't panic at the graphs. Vacuum runs weekly, Sundays. Failover is manual — runbook is on the wiki under "Meadow Ops." Ping the media team before restarting anything mid-encode.

For connecting to the primary, use the string below.

primary connection of yagep-kahip = redis://giliel_svc:zYiKsLL2PLpfPL@db-348f.xolmarsys.corp:5432/fenwyn